The movement inside the Earth's crust is studied by which of the following?
A. Geology
B. Seismology
C. Plate Tectonics
D. Pantograph
Answer: Option B
Solution(By Examveda Team)
The study of vibration inside Earth's crust which are caused due to natural or artificial sources such as earthquakes or explosions is called seismology. The scientists who study such vibrations are known as the seismologists.Related Questions on Lithosphere
